The Benue State Chapter of the Peoples Democratic Party, PDP, has congratulated incumbent Governor Samuel Ortom on his re-election as Governor of Benue state.
The party has also called on all stakeholders, particularly those who contested with him to shun any form of litigation for the overall development of Benue.
The Chairman of the party, Mr. John Ngbede stated this in a congratulatory message signed by the State Publicity Secretary, PDP, Bemgba Iortyom.
Ngbede, who expressed ultimate gratitude to God for making possible the peaceful conduct of the 2019 elections also congratulated the good people of Benue State for their distinct show of maturity in staying on the path of peace throughout the period of the elections despite efforts from certain quarters targeted at instigating strife and rancour.
He said the victory handed to the PDP by Benue people in 2019 ranks in historical significance to that won by the blacks in Apartheid South Africa, the Abolitionist movements in the United States of America and the protagonists of the Arab Spring in the Middle East.
He said the victory will forever be contained in the chronicles of Nigeria’s political history that in 2019 Benue people across social, religious and tribal lines, Ibo, Youruba, Hausa, Igala, Nupe, Jukun, and others, joining forces with the indigenes, voted in overwhelming majority to keep power in the hands of a Governor and a political party which stood up for them against a federal government.
He said, “Benue people in 2019 have voted to keep power in the hands of Governor Samuel Ortom and the PDP at all levels of political leadership representation.
“This is an article of faith which in the next four years will be treated with all sense of due diligence and seriousness.
“Benue PDP congratulate her own very distinguished followership; the leaders, elders, women and youths, who worked tirelessly with unwavering loyalty to achieve the landmark victory at the 2019 polls.

He maintained that the result of the 2019 elections represents the fruits of the revitalisation work which was started in 2015 by committed loyalists after the party lost power at the elections of that year.
“Today the people of Benue State have enacted a fresh pact with PDP, a pact of trust and partnership in the expression of faith that what lies ahead is by far greater than that which is in the past.
He therefore called all stakeholders to the Benue project to heed the call to reconciliation and mutual co-operation made by Governor Samuel Ortom in his speech accepting the mandate to serve the people for another tenure of four years.
He particularly enjoined all who aspired to lead the people of Benue in the various elective offices at the just concluded elections to put the polls where they now belong, in the past, and to train their sights on the Benue project.
Ngbede said in turning around from their various positions and embracing one another, they would be fast-tracking the process of tackling the arrears of development staring the state in the face.
“In making this call we are mindful of the unfortunate events of 2011 when post election litigation bogged down the state government administration in power then, depriving the state of much needed attention for development.
“We therefore extend this olive branch to our opponents whom we respect for the quality of the electoral contest and enjoin them to, while maintaining their identities where they do not see a need to cross over to our side, at least allow healthy space for the thriving of developmental governance in the best interests of Benue.
